Why Private Accommodation Is a Solid Backup, Not a Downgrade
Purpose-built student accommodation (PBSA) makes up most of Liverpool’s private student housing. It is built for students and usually comes fully furnished, with bills included and top amenities such as gyms, cinemas, and study spaces. It is not lower quality than university halls; the main difference is that it is privately managed. With over 63,000 students across Liverpool’s universities, there are plenty of private student housing options for those who do not get a place in university halls.

Studios in Liverpool won’t always fit within a £121- £180/Week budget. They usually start from around £99/week, but newer or better-located options may cost over £180/week. Comparing different properties can help find a better deal.
What to Check When Booking Private Accommodation Instead of Halls
- Distance to your specific campus building: Since the University of Liverpool has multiple sites, and "near the university" can mean different things depending on which one you attend
- Whether bills are genuinely included: Most properties listed on UniAcco include utility bills in the rent, but it's always good to read the agreement carefully for the deposit and rent amount as well.
- Guarantor requirements: If you are paying in instalments, you may need a UK-based guarantor.
- Contract length: Since private tenancies often run 36–44 or up to 51 weeks, worth matching against your actual term dates
